Address

ecash:qz8su0m3sw2slx937q7yejy8yvm84305dv0g2h62pxCopy

Total Received

5969203.88 XEC

Total Sent

5969203.88 XEC

№ Transactions

109

Final Balance

0 XEC

Transactions
Filter